Joann SMITH Obituary

Joann (Lacey) SMITH August 22, 1940 - October 20, 2011 Our beautiful mother passed from this world into the loving arms of our Savior to be reunited with family and friends that have gone before. We are comforted knowing that we, her daughters, were by her side as she transitioned on. A silent warrior, she fought a brave and valiant battle with pulmonary fibrosis, refusing to let it define who she was and choosing to live life to the fullest until she just could no longer. Her wings are now restored and she is off on her travels again. Her gift to this world was touching everyone she knew with love, compassion and open arms, welcoming people into her family and making them feel like they never belonged anywhere else. Her legacy of love will forever live on in her most treasured possessions, her family. We are forever indebted to her. Left behind are her daughters, Annette Smith, Yvonne Rasmussen (Earl), Yvette O'Connell (Desmond), her grandchildren, Vince, Chris, Collette, Aislinn, Cailin and Carson, and her former husband and good friend, Fred Smith. Services will be held Friday, October 28th, noon, at Our Lady of the Lake Church. In lieu of flowers please make a donation in Joann's name to St. Francis House, 169 12th Ave, Seattle, WA 98122 (206) 621-0945.
